| package org.apache.mina.transport.socket.nio; |
| |
| import java.io.IOException; |
| import java.net.InetSocketAddress; |
| import java.net.SocketAddress; |
| import java.nio.channels.DatagramChannel; |
| import java.util.Collections; |
| import java.util.Iterator; |
| import java.util.concurrent.Executor; |
| |
| import org.apache.mina.core.polling.AbstractPollingIoConnector; |
| import org.apache.mina.core.service.IoConnector; |
| import org.apache.mina.core.service.IoProcessor; |
| import org.apache.mina.core.service.SimpleIoProcessorPool; |
| import org.apache.mina.core.service.TransportMetadata; |
| import org.apache.mina.transport.socket.DatagramConnector; |
| import org.apache.mina.transport.socket.DatagramSessionConfig; |
| import org.apache.mina.transport.socket.DefaultDatagramSessionConfig; |
| |
| /** |
| * {@link IoConnector} for datagram transport (UDP/IP). |
| * |
| * @author <a href="http://mina.apache.org">Apache MINA Project</a> |
| */ |
| public final class NioDatagramConnector extends AbstractPollingIoConnector<NioSession, DatagramChannel> implements |
| DatagramConnector { |
| |
| /** |
| * Creates a new instance. |
| */ |
| public NioDatagramConnector() { |
| super(new DefaultDatagramSessionConfig(), NioProcessor.class); |
| } |
| |
| /** |
| * Creates a new instance. |
| * |
| * @param processorCount The number of IoProcessor instance to create |
| */ |
| public NioDatagramConnector(int processorCount) { |
| super(new DefaultDatagramSessionConfig(), NioProcessor.class, processorCount); |
| } |
| |
| /** |
| * Creates a new instance. |
| * |
| * @param processor The IoProcessor instance to use |
| */ |
| public NioDatagramConnector(IoProcessor<NioSession> processor) { |
| super(new DefaultDatagramSessionConfig(), processor); |
| } |
| |
| /** |
| * Constructor for {@link NioDatagramConnector} with default configuration which will use a built-in |
| * thread pool executor to manage the given number of processor instances. The processor class must have |
| * a constructor that accepts ExecutorService or Executor as its single argument, or, failing that, a |
| * no-arg constructor. |
| * |
| * @param processorClass the processor class. |
| * @param processorCount the number of processors to instantiate. |
| * @see SimpleIoProcessorPool#SimpleIoProcessorPool(Class, Executor, int, java.nio.channels.spi.SelectorProvider) |
| * @since 2.0.0-M4 |
| */ |
| public NioDatagramConnector(Class<? extends IoProcessor<NioSession>> processorClass, int processorCount) { |
| super(new DefaultDatagramSessionConfig(), processorClass, processorCount); |
| } |
| |
| /** |
| * Constructor for {@link NioDatagramConnector} with default configuration with default configuration which will use a built-in |
| * thread pool executor to manage the default number of processor instances. The processor class must have |
| * a constructor that accepts ExecutorService or Executor as its single argument, or, failing that, a |
| * no-arg constructor. The default number of instances is equal to the number of processor cores |
| * in the system, plus one. |
| * |
| * @param processorClass the processor class. |
| * @see SimpleIoProcessorPool#SimpleIoProcessorPool(Class, Executor, int, java.nio.channels.spi.SelectorProvider) |
| * @since 2.0.0-M4 |
| */ |
| public NioDatagramConnector(Class<? extends IoProcessor<NioSession>> processorClass) { |
| super(new DefaultDatagramSessionConfig(), processorClass); |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| public TransportMetadata getTransportMetadata() { |
| return NioDatagramSession.METADATA; |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| public DatagramSessionConfig getSessionConfig() { |
| return (DatagramSessionConfig) sessionConfig; |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| public InetSocketAddress getDefaultRemoteAddress() { |
| return (InetSocketAddress) super.getDefaultRemoteAddress(); |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| public void setDefaultRemoteAddress(InetSocketAddress defaultRemoteAddress) { |
| super.setDefaultRemoteAddress(defaultRemoteAddress); |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| protected void init() throws Exception { |
| // Do nothing |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| protected DatagramChannel newHandle(SocketAddress localAddress) throws Exception { |
| DatagramChannel ch = DatagramChannel.open(); |
| |
| try { |
| if (localAddress != null) { |
| try { |
| ch.socket().bind(localAddress); |
| setDefaultLocalAddress(localAddress); |
| } catch (IOException ioe) { |
| // Add some info regarding the address we try to bind to the |
| // message |
| String newMessage = "Error while binding on " + localAddress + "\n" + "original message : " |
| + ioe.getMessage(); |
| Exception e = new IOException(newMessage); |
| e.initCause(ioe.getCause()); |
| |
| // and close the channel |
| ch.close(); |
| |
| throw e; |
| } |
| } |
| |
| return ch; |
| } catch (Exception e) { |
| // If we got an exception while binding the datagram, |
| // we have to close it otherwise we will loose an handle |
| ch.close(); |
| throw e; |
| } |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| protected boolean connect(DatagramChannel handle, SocketAddress remoteAddress) throws Exception { |
| handle.connect(remoteAddress); |
| return true; |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| protected NioSession newSession(IoProcessor<NioSession> processor, DatagramChannel handle) { |
| NioSession session = new NioDatagramSession(this, handle, processor); |
| session.getConfig().setAll(getSessionConfig()); |
| return session; |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| protected void close(DatagramChannel handle) throws Exception { |
| handle.disconnect(); |
| handle.close(); |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| // Unused extension points. |
| @Override |
| protected Iterator<DatagramChannel> allHandles() { |
| return Collections.emptyIterator(); |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| protected ConnectionRequest getConnectionRequest(DatagramChannel handle) { |
| throw new UnsupportedOperationException(); |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| protected void destroy() throws Exception { |
| // Do nothing |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| protected boolean finishConnect(DatagramChannel handle) throws Exception { |
| throw new UnsupportedOperationException(); |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| protected void register(DatagramChannel handle, ConnectionRequest request) throws Exception { |
| throw new UnsupportedOperationException(); |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| protected int select(int timeout) throws Exception { |
| return 0; |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| protected Iterator<DatagramChannel> selectedHandles() { |
| return Collections.emptyIterator(); |
| } |
| |
| /** |
| * {@inheritDoc} |
| */ |
| @Override |
| protected void wakeup() { |
| // Do nothing |
| } |
| } |
